Re: Domoticz, Pi3, RaZberry & Raspbian Jessie
It could be a faulty Razberry module. When you power up your Pi, does the red LED on the Razberry module illuminate for around 1 second? As another test, you could try installing the z-way server, as that has more diagnostic capabilities than those provided within Domoticz. If you do install it ...
